## Canary Gating — Reviewer Notes

Canary deploys on the Fenwick platform gate on three rules: error rate under 0.5% for 30 minutes, p99 latency within 10% of baseline, and zero failed health probes. Reviewers must confirm the gating config is unchanged before approving promotion. Manual overrides require two approvals and are logged. Canary bundles must be signed before the gate will admit them; the signing key is below.

rollout seal: bky9_PeXH1fTLY

### Step 4: Apply Rate Limit Changes to Gatewing

Rate limits for the internal Gatewing API gateway live in `limits.yaml` under the `burst` and `sustained` keys. Never edit limits directly on a running node; push through the Relayard pipeline so every replica converges within one polling cycle. Verify with `gatewing-cli limits --verify` before and after rollout, and watch the 429 panel for ten minutes. The deployment must be signed with the key below.

signing key of bagap-yawep = bky13_TbfT6ZMUoGJo2

## Fan-out stalls (Gustline alerts)

If weather alerts pile up in the outbound queue, it's almost always the fan-out workers hitting the per-region rate cap. Check the Gustline dashboard first — a sawtooth on the dispatch graph confirms it. Bumping worker count past 12 has never helped; raise the batch size instead. Before you approve any change here, compare against the values we actually run with, which follow.

settings of yageg-yahap:
[gorael]
team = olieth
access_code = ac_941d74
owner = brieth.aldiel
host = gorael.tolvaqio.internal
port = 6379
peer = briwyn.urlaqtech.internal
salt = 116e6622
pin = 1957